Need help, gun safe is locked, and I can't find the combination. It's a Cannon safe, American Eagle series, do I call Cannon, or do I call the local locksmith and hope he can get into it, or is their anything I can do. I really don't want just anybody seeing my safe, let alone whats in there. I'm sure i'll be flamed over this, so go ahead, but I really need help on this. Thanks

I had an opportunity to pick up a used safe with a locked door. (nobody knew the combo) So, before I picked it up I called a locksmith and asked how much to unlock and reset the combo. I was told that it would cost me $350.00 to do this. YMMV
Call some local locksmiths for a quote. Have your lock type and model if you have it ready to give him/her.
